      There must be a way to export the information shown in the Reviews tab to an excel file, similar to the excel export in the Jira issue navigator.

      The point is not to export all the review data (e.g. comments). That may be a good idea, but would be a separate feature request. Just follow the model of the Jira issue navigator!

            How do I export all crucible review comments of a project to excel?
            I am using crucible v2.7.7

            I want to export all (500-1000) review comments / defects of a project, with all details like Review ID, reviewer name, creation date and all custom fields (crucible defect classifications : ranking, classification etc) as separate columns in an excel sheet.

            Crucible doesnt seem to give me this option by default.

            I tried to use a MS SQL query to directly get the data from the DB, but am unable to find the tables where the Crucible "Defect Classification" fields are stored.

            Is there an easier way to get this data?
            This is needed in our organization for varoius other reports.
            Now getting this data out is a major overhead and team is questioning the usage of crucible because of this overhead.

            Hi Sten,

            We're looking here for the list of reviews with fields such as review key, reviews, etc - not the list of reviews linked to a particular issue. Just think in terms of the Jira issue navigator, but the objects are reviews, not issues. (We discussed this already in CRC-4848. I'm not asking for all of that now, just the excel export)

            The use case is making a report (e.g. a chart) about the adoption of Crucible in different areas of development. I uploaded an excel file to give you an idea. The raw data had to be put together by hand, using the existing review query functionality - something one would normally expect the tool to do.
